1.Olfactory Receptors Expressed in The Intestine and Their Functions
Pei-Wen YANG ; Meng-Meng YUAN ; Ying ZHOU ; Peng LI ; Gui-Hong QI ; Ying YANG ; Zhong-Yi MAO ; Meng-Sha ZHOU ; Xiao-Shuang MAO ; Jian-Ping XIE ; Yi-Nan YANG ; Shi-Hao SUN
Progress in Biochemistry and Biophysics 2026;53(3):534-549
Olfactory receptors (ORs) form the largest superfamily of G protein-coupled receptors (GPCRs). Traditionally recognized for their role in the nasal olfactory epithelium, where they mediate the sense of smell, accumulating evidence has firmly established their ectopic expression in non-olfactory tissues, including the intestine, lungs, and kidneys. The intestine, as the primary site for nutrient digestion and absorption, harbors a highly complex chemical environment. To adapt to this environment, the gut employs a sophisticated network of “chemosensors” to monitor luminal contents and maintain homeostasis. Among these sensors, intestinal ORs have emerged as crucial functional components, serving as a molecular bridge that connects environmental chemical signals—such as food-derived odorants—to specific physiological responses. This discovery has significantly deepened our understanding of how dietary flavors and compounds influence intestinal physiology at the molecular level. This review systematically summarizes the expression profiles, ligand classification, and biological functions of ORs within the gastrointestinal tract. Studies indicate that intestinal ORs exhibit distinct spatial distribution patterns across different gut segments and display cell-type specificity, particularly within enterocytes and enteroendocrine cells. These receptors function as versatile sensors capable of recognizing a wide variety of ligands, including exogenous dietary components, gut microbiota metabolites such as short-chain fatty acids, and endogenous small molecules like azelaic acid. Upon activation by specific ligands, intestinal ORs trigger intracellular signaling cascades, primarily involving the AC-cAMP-PKA pathway or calcium influx channels. A major focus of this review is to elucidate the molecular mechanisms by which these receptors regulate the secretion of gut hormones. Activation of specific ORs in enteroendocrine cells has been shown to stimulate the release of hormones such as glucagon-like peptide-1 (GLP-1), peptide YY (PYY), and serotonin (5-HT), thereby modulating systemic energy metabolism, glucose homeostasis, and gastrointestinal motility. Furthermore, the review addresses the critical roles of ORs in immune regulation and pathology. Evidence suggests that specific ORs contribute to the maintenance of intestinal immune homeostasis and may offer protection against inflammation. Beyond their involvement in inflammatory responses, ORs such as Olfr78 have been shown to regulate the differentiation and function of intestinal endocrine cells. Similarly, Olfr544 has been demonstrated to alleviate intestinal inflammation by remodeling the gut microbiome and metabolome. These findings collectively suggest that specific ORs hold promise as therapeutic targets for mitigating intestinal inflammation and maintaining gut homeostasis. Additionally, the review explores the emerging role of ORs in cancer. Although OR expression is often downregulated in tumor tissues compared to normal mucosa, activation of specific ORs by certain ligands can inhibit tumor cell proliferation and migration and induce apoptosis via pathways such as MEK/ERK and p38 MAPK. Conversely, other receptors, such as OR7C1, may serve as biomarkers for cancer-initiating cells. In conclusion, intestinal ORs represent a vital component of the gut’s sensory network. The review also discusses the translational potential of these findings. By elucidating the precise pairing relationships between dietary components and specific ORs, novel therapeutic strategies could be developed. Intestinal ORs may thus emerge as promising targets for nutritional and pharmacological interventions in metabolic diseases, inflammatory bowel diseases, and malignancies.

3.Analysis of efficacy and safety of sintilimab combined with SOX regimen in adjuvant treatment of stage Ⅲ gastric cancer
Zhou BAIQUAN ; Liu LIN ; Tang YUFAN ; Wen BINGBING ; Sha YING ; Jia JIAJIA ; Yu KE ; Xu SHUMEI ; Fan RUIFANG
Chinese Journal of Clinical Oncology 2025;52(17):870-876
Objective:To investigate the efficacy and safety of sintilimab combined with the SOX regimen for adjuvant treatment of stage Ⅲgastric cancer after D2 radical resection and to provide a reference for individualized clinical treatment.Methods:The clinical data of 245 pa-tients with stage III gastric cancer who underwent D2 radical resection at the 940th Hospital of the Joint Support Force of the People's Liber-ation Army from June 2019 to May 2022 were retrospectively analyzed.The 180 patients who received only the SOX regimen were desig-nated the control group,and the 65 patients who received sintilimab combined with the SOX regimen were designated the experimental group.The 3-year disease-free survival(DFS)rate,overall survival(OS)rate,and adverse reactions among the two groups and different sub-groups(HER-2 positive,dMMR,CPS≥5)were compared.Results:The 3-year DFS(81.5%vs.59.4%)and OS(84.6%vs.70.6%)rates in the experimental group were significantly higher than those in the control group(both P<0.05).Group analysis showed that in patients with CPS≥5,the 3-year DFS(91.5%vs.67.0%)and OS(95.7%vs.71.6%)rates within the experimental group were significantly better than those in the control group(both P<0.05).Intra-group analysis within the experimental group showed that the 3-year DFS rate(91.5%vs.55.6%)and OS rate(95.7%vs.55.6%)of patients with CPS≥5 were significantly better than those of patients with CPS<5(both P<0.05).The overall and grade≥3 incidences of liver and kidney function damage,thyroid dysfunction,colitis,pneumonia,and rash in the experimental group were higher than those in the control group(all P<0.05),while the differences in other adverse reactions,including leukopenia were not statistic-ally significant(all P>0.05).Conclusions:Sintilimab combined with the SOX regimen can significantly improve 3-year DFS and OS rates in pa-tients with stage Ⅲ gastric cancer after surgery,especially in the CPS≥5 subgroup,with significant benefits and controllable safety.
4.Study on the Therapeutic Effect of Banxia Baizhu Tianma Decoction on Phlegm-dampness-blocked Cervical Vertigo and Its Influence on Neck Hemodynamics
Chun-feng WU ; Meng-ying TIAN ; Jia-luo CAI ; Sha-ting LIU ; Xiao-ping LI
Progress in Modern Biomedicine 2025;25(9):1503-1509
Objective:To explore the therapeutic effect of Banxia Baizhu Tianma Decoction on phlegm-dampness-blocking cervical vertigo and its influence on neck hemodynamics.Methods:96 patients with phlegm-dampness block type cervical vertigo admitted to our hospital from January 2022 to January 2024 were divided into control group and observation group,48 cases in each group.The control group was treated with conventional Western medicine,and the observation group was treated with Banxia Baizhu Tianma Decoction.Both groups were treated for 4 weeks and followed up for 6 months.The reduction time and disappearance time of vertigo were recorded.The score of cervical vertigo Symptom and Function Assessment Scale(ESCV)was performed before treatment and 1 day after treatment.The average blood flow level of basilar artery,right vertebral artery and left vertebral artery was detected,and the total clinical effective rate,recurrence rate and adverse reaction rate of the two groups were compared.Results:The reduction time and disappearance time of vertigo in the observation group were shorter than those in the control group(P<0.05).Post-treatment,the ESCV score of both groups was higher than that before treatment;compared with the control group,the ESCV score of the observation group was higher post-treatment(P<0.05).The total clinical effective rate of observation group was higher than that of control group,and the recurrence rate was lower than that of control group(P<0.05).The hemodynamic index were higher after treatment than in the control group(P<0.05).There was no difference in the incidence of adverse reactions between the two groups(P>0.05).Conclusion:Banxia Baizhu Tianma Decoction has certain curative effect on phlegm-dampness block type cervical vertigo,can effectively relieve vertigo symptoms,reduce recurrence,improve neck hemodynamics,and is safe,worthy of popularization and application.

6.Establishment and application of quality control system for medical record front page coding in a hos-pital
Junfeng LIU ; Ziyi XIN ; Sha LIU ; Zhuochen LIN ; Ying XIONG
Modern Hospital 2025;25(9):1360-1362
Objective Analyze the causes of coding issues in the inpatient medical record homepage of a hospital and propose targeted improvement measures,providing a reference basis for enhancing coding quality.Methods A total of 3 000 in-patient medical records from April 1,2021,to March 31,2022(pre-intervention group)and 2 900 records from April 1,2022,to March 31,2023(post-intervention group)were selected for analysis.Quality control statistics were performed on key indica-tors,including the overall coding accuracy rate,primary diagnosis coding,secondary diagnosis coding,primary surgical proce-dure coding,and other surgical procedure coding.Results After the implementation of intervention measures,the overall accu-racy rate of the first page coding of medical records increased from 80.77%to 86.72%(P<0.001).While,the accuracy rate for primary diagnosis coding improved from 96.90%to 98.07%(P<0.05).The secondary diagnosis coding accuracy showed significant enhancement from 87.48%to 92.26%(P<0.001),and primary surgical procedure coding accuracy rose from 96.50%to 98.34%(P<0.001).Although other surgical procedure coding demonstrated improvement,the difference was not statistically significant(P>0.05).Conclusion Through a series of measures—including standardized training for coders,es-tablishing a robust quality control system,and adopting advanced information technology—both the professionalism of coders and coding efficiency were enhanced.These interventions effectively reduced coding defects and improved the quality of medical re-cord homepage coding.

9.Application effect of visual eye dressings in patients after bilateral strabismus surgery
Wei SONG ; Ying SHA ; Hang YIN ; Zhangfang MA
Chinese Journal of Modern Nursing 2025;31(17):2335-2337
Objective:To explore the application effect of visual eye dressings in patients after bilateral strabismus surgery.Methods:A total of 60 patients who underwent bilateral strabismus surgery in the Department of Ophthalmology of Beijing Tongren Hospital, Capital Medical University, from March to August 2024, were selected by convenience sampling. The patients were randomly divided into an observation group and a control group using a random number table method, with 30 cases in each group. After surgery, the control group was treated with conventional eye dressings, while the observation group was treated with visual eye dressings. The daily living ability, unplanned dressing changes were compared between the two groups.Results:The observation group had higher daily living ability scores and fewer unplanned dressing changes than the control group, and the differences were statistically significant ( P<0.05) . Conclusions:The use of visual eye dressings in patients after bilateral strabismus surgery has a positive effect on maintaining daily living ability and reducing the frequency of unplanned dressing changes.
10.Criteria and prognostic models for patients with hepatocellular carcinoma undergoing liver transplantation
Meng SHA ; Jun WANG ; Jie CAO ; Zhi-Hui ZOU ; Xiao-ye QU ; Zhi-feng XI ; Chuan SHEN ; Ying TONG ; Jian-jun ZHANG ; Seogsong JEONG ; Qiang XIA
Clinical and Molecular Hepatology 2025;31(Suppl):S285-S300
Hepatocellular carcinoma (HCC) is a leading cause of cancer-associated death globally. Liver transplantation (LT) has emerged as a key treatment for patients with HCC, and the Milan criteria have been adopted as the cornerstone of the selection policy. To allow more patients to benefit from LT, a number of expanded criteria have been proposed, many of which use radiologic morphological characteristics with larger and more tumors as surrogates to predict outcomes. Other groups developed indices incorporating biological variables and dynamic markers of response to locoregional treatment. These expanded selection criteria achieved satisfactory results with limited liver supplies. In addition, a number of prognostic models have been developed using clinicopathological characteristics, imaging radiomics features, genetic data, and advanced techniques such as artificial intelligence. These models could improve prognostic estimation, establish surveillance strategies, and bolster long-term outcomes in patients with HCC. In this study, we reviewed the latest findings and achievements regarding the selection criteria and post-transplant prognostic models for LT in patients with HCC.
